Sodium is a solid at 20 degrees Celsius. It melts at 97.8 degrees Celsius and boils at 882.9 degrees Celsius.
Neon at 20 degrees Celsius would be in a gaseous state. Neon naturally exists as a gas at room temperature and pressure.
Cadmium is a solid at 20 degrees Celsius. It has a melting point of 321.07 degrees Celsius, so at 20 degrees Celsius it would be in its solid state.
Nitrogen is a gas at 20 degrees Celsius. It has a boiling point of -196 degrees Celsius, so at 20 degrees Celsius, it is well above its boiling point and exists as a gas.
Boiling at 20 degrees Celsius is a physical property. Chemical properties involve changes in the chemical composition of a substance, while physical properties describe the state or appearance of a substance without changing its composition.
